Church for Every Context by Michael Moynagh

The first comprehensive textbook on the theology and methodology of Fresh Expressions, one of the most important developments within the contemporary church.

Michael Moynagh is a member of the Fresh Expressions Team with responsibility for drawing together learning about the theology and practice of new forms of church. He written or been lead author of more than ten books, including Changing World, Changing Church and Emerging Church.intro. Philip Harrold is Associate Professor of Church History at the Trinity School for Ministry in Ambridge, PA.
